WebYour grandaunt is your grandparent’s sister, and you are her grandniece or grandnephew. Many call their grandaunt or granduncle their “great” aunt or “great” uncle. Examples: 3rd-great-grandson (replacing great-great-great-grandson), 4th-great-grandfather, 2nd-great-grandnephew, step-3rd-great-granddaughter, 6th-great-grandaunt.
